Lion Pride: the Faen

Located in Khankirae, the Faen pride is an offshoot of the Mahdros that fled hundreds of years previously from an unknown cataclysm. Though smaller than their father-pride, they are led much more traditionally, and hold governance over much of Khankirae. Allies with the veldryn, they often aid their allies in battle - though recent loss has made them wary and standoffish around strangers.

Due to their more traditional way of governance, male lions are few, and most male offspring that do not either become Heirs, Menders or Guards are outsted from the pride to create their own smaller prides under Faen leadership in Khankirae. Most often, no more than ten males - all unrelated, save for Princes or Kings - are allowed in the pride at any given time. Elder males who are retired Guards/Shamans/Kings are allowed to stay.

If the Guard, Menders/Shamans or Heirs are too related, Guards and Shamans are often asked to leave, and unrelated males are elevated to take their place. There exists an agreement between the Faen and the Mahdros to exchange interested adolescents every few years, just to keep bloodlines clean.


The Faen pride is near half of the Mahdros' overall size, and rules a much smaller area, responsible for the continent of Khankirae, some of Alubria (working with the gryphons of the Anarya), and some of western Nimravus (with tenuous allies amid the deathcat prides). Smaller prides and lesser kings or queens will often meet with the Faen king, discussing news, cubs, bloodlines, hunting and more. Often, the Faen may be called to oversee claims, disputes or wars, but rarely take sides beyond an objective view of justice.

All ranks are listed below.

King;; Is the leader of the pride and almost exclusively male. The King is war-leader, strategizing and always commanding during battles, however rarely participates in hunts. When the King becomes too old or weak to lead the pride, they will either step down to become a normal pride member or be challenged and, if defeated, exiled.
Queen;; Is the King's preferred mate and "sub-leader" of the pride, responsible for directing hunts and leading the pride when the King is otherwise occupied. All lions except the King and Shaman defer to the Queen.
Heirs (Prince/Princess);; Is the strongest lion - or lioness -under the King and Queen and the likely successor. This position is fluid and subject to change based on the outcomes of battles for dominance but is usually held by one of the King or Queen's offspring.
Shaman;; Is the pride healer, skilled in herbs as well as healing magic and highly respected by the pride. They are considered equal to the King and Queen but rarely use their authority. As such, a lion cannot become the Shaman until they are at least thirty years of age, except under extreme circumstances. The Shaman is responsible for the health of the Pride and training their successor, which they begin searching for as soon as they gain the position.
Mender;; Is the pride's apprentice healer, trained by the Shaman to succeed them when they pass. The Mender is a lion of usually magical ability - usually centered around healing - and is educated from a young age in the remedial arts.
Guard;; A small group of mostly-male lions who protect the pride, patrol the borders, and keep the lionesses safe from attack. It's said that the Guard was founded to stave off deathcat attacks many years ago. Generally, the Guard will have around three to four male lions in it.

Pride members who do not hold position are simply called thus; the elders and cubs are generally included in this group, as well as the hunters and any lions that are considered invalid but can perform duties like minding cubs.
